Beyond Suffering

People with disabilities are considered one of the world’s largest under-represented groups.
The church is largely unprepared for the burgeoning disabled population.

One of the primary goals of the Beyond Suffering Course is to address this issue by preparing leaders in ministry, education, medicine, and science to become involved in this life-changing ministry.

Introduction for Leaders

Beyond Suffering: An Introduction for Christian Leaders is designed especially for busy pastors and others who seek to lead their congregations into deeper ministry to families living with disability in their community. This FREE four-lesson introduction to Beyond Suffering will help you get started. It is available in nine languages.
